Advertisement

爬虫前端实训项目报告(包含源代码及Nginx服务器配置)

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:RAR


简介:
本报告详细记录了爬虫前端实训项目的开发过程,包括功能设计、技术选型和调试经验,并附有完整的源代码及Nginx服务器配置说明。 爬虫前端实训项目报告(包含源代码,包括前端部分及Nginx服务端)。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Nginx
    优质
    本报告详细记录了爬虫前端实训项目的开发过程,包括功能设计、技术选型和调试经验,并附有完整的源代码及Nginx服务器配置说明。 爬虫前端实训项目报告(包含源代码,包括前端部分及Nginx服务端)。
  • Nginx web部署Vue
    优质
    本篇文章介绍如何在Nginx Web服务器上成功部署基于Vue.js框架开发的前端项目,涵盖了配置及优化技巧。 Nginx 是一款高性能的 HTTP 和反向代理 Web 服务器,以其强大的并发处理能力和低内存消耗而著称。它可以支持高达50,000个并发连接数,使其成为高流量站点的理想选择。在中国大陆,许多大型互联网公司如百度、京东、新浪、网易和腾讯都使用 Nginx。 Nginx 的主要特点包括: - **高性能**:能够高效处理大量并发请求。 - **低内存占用**:在相同工作负载下消耗的内存较少。 - **高度可配置性**:通过灵活地定制各种功能和服务,满足不同需求。 - **稳定性**:经过长时间的发展和完善,在稳定性方面表现出色。 ### Nginx 作为 Web 服务器的应用 Nginx 不仅可以处理静态资源,还支持通过 CGI 协议处理动态内容(例如 Perl 和 PHP)。然而,对于 Java 应用程序的支持,则需要与 Tomcat 等其他应用服务器配合使用。此外,它提供了丰富的安全特性如 HTTPS 支持和访问控制等,并且具有高度的灵活性。 ### 部署前端 Vue 项目至 Nginx 部署基于 Vue.js 的前端项目到 Nginx 上的基本步骤如下: 1. **准备环境**: - 确保系统上已经安装了 Nginx。 - 准备好已构建完成静态资源文件的 Vue 项目。 2. **拷贝项目文件**: 将构建好的 Vue 项目的静态资源文件复制到 Nginx 的 `html` 文件夹中。例如,使用命令如下: ``` cp -r pathtovue-project/dist/* /usr/share/nginx/html ``` 3. **配置 Nginx**: 编辑 Nginx 配置文件(通常位于 `/etc/nginx/` 目录下),添加一个新的 server 块来指向 Vue 项目。例如,可以这样设置: ```nginx server { listen 80; server_name example.com; root /usr/share/nginx/html; index index.html index.htm; location / { try_files $uri $uri/ /index.html; # 处理单页面应用路由 } } ``` 4. **重启 Nginx**: 使用命令 `sudo service nginx restart` 以重新加载配置文件。 5. **测试部署**: 在浏览器中输入域名或 IP 地址,检查 Vue.js 应用是否成功部署并运行良好。 ### 总结 Nginx 是一个出色的 Web 服务器,适用于处理高并发请求,并支持各种类型的 Web 应用程序。对于前端 Vue 项目来说,通过简单的配置步骤即可将其高效地部署到 Nginx 上,从而充分利用其高性能和稳定性特点。无论是个人开发者还是企业级应用,Nginx 都是值得考虑的选择之一。
  • WEB:Web详解
    优质
    本实训报告详细探讨了Web服务器配置的相关知识和技术要点,包括服务器软件的选择、网站搭建流程以及安全性设置等关键环节。适合对Web开发和运维感兴趣的读者参考学习。 web服务器配置实训报告涵盖了多个方面的内容,包括但不限于对web服务器的安装、设置以及优化等相关知识的实际操作与应用分析。通过这一过程,学员能够深入理解并掌握如何有效进行web服务器的相关配置工作,并在此基础上进一步探索其在实际项目中的具体应用和潜在挑战。
  • Java:计算
    优质
    本项目为基于Java语言开发的计算器应用实训,涵盖基础算术运算功能,并提供完整源代码和详细的实验报告。适合编程学习与实践参考。 课题的主要目标是利用Java基础知识和技术完成数据运算。应用的技术主要包括异常处理,在完成后可以实现有限范围内整数的累加和连乘计算。
  • VueNginx与部署.md
    优质
    本文档详细介绍了如何在Nginx服务器上进行Vue.js前端项目的配置和部署步骤,包括环境搭建、项目构建及优化技巧。 Vue前端项目部署之Nginx配置。
  • DNS.docx
    优质
    本实验报告详细记录了DNS服务器的配置过程,包括理论分析、实践操作步骤及遇到的问题和解决方案。通过本次实验,加深了对域名解析系统工作原理的理解与应用能力。 2020年12月13日下午修订了标准化办公室,并且配置DNS服务器实验报告全文共4页,当前为第1页。 **实验目的:** 1. 掌握DNS服务器的安装步骤。 2. 配置并测试DNS服务器。 **实验环境:** 局域网Windows Server 2003提供的服务器 **实验内容:** 学习配置DNS域名服务器。在开始之前,绘制一棵虚构的域名树以了解其结构,并掌握DNS服务的安装和配置方法以及进行相应的测试。 **实验步骤:** 1. 在实际操作前先画出一个虚拟的域名树。 2. 安装Windows Server 2003 DNS服务: - 如果在第一次安装时没有选择DNS服务器,可以通过“开始”菜单进入控制面板,然后使用添加/删除程序来安装它。按照向导指示进行设置,并确保选中了DNS选项。 3. 配置并测试DNS服务器: a) 在Windows Server 2003 Enterprise Edition中点击 所有程序管理工具DNS, 打开DNS控制台。 b) 创建用于存储授权区域名字信息的数据库,建立一个正向查找区域,并将该区域的信息保存在指定的数据文件中。可以通过执行“新建区域”命令来创建一个新的域名空间。 c) 在新创建的区域内添加资源记录: - 使用新建主机命令可以为一台主机设置IP地址; - 使用新建别名命令可以让一个主机拥有多个名称; - 使用新建邮件交换器命令将电子邮件服务器与其对应的主机名进行绑定。 d) 修改或删除资源记录:双击某条记录以修改它,或者右键点击并选择“删除”来移除不需要的项。 4. 客户端配置: 在客户端的TCP/IP属性中设置DNS服务器地址以便能够通过域名解析IP地址。 5. 测试DNS服务是否正常工作。在命令提示符下输入 ping 命令,如果返回正确的IP地址,则说明DNS服务已经成功安装和配置。 **实验小结:** 本次学习使我们掌握了基本的DNS服务器设置方法,并且熟悉了如何使用Windows Server 2003虚拟机进行相关操作。通过本实验还了解到了分布式数据库系统的原理以及其容错性特点,这为将来更深入地理解和应用DNS技术打下了坚实的基础。
  • Android毕设客户
    优质
    本项目为一款Android毕业设计作品,涵盖完整客户端应用及配套服务器端源码。旨在提供详尽的技术实现参考,助力开发者深入理解移动应用开发流程。 这是本人的毕业设计(包含论文、结构图及源码),包括Android客户端、Java Socket服务器以及Java Web服务器,实现了一个完整的项目。 可以直接运行客户端中的apk文件查看效果。(我的阿里云上的web服务器和socket服务器均已开启) 此外,文档内含详细说明。由于文件较大,请见谅。希望这个项目能够帮助到更多的人!
  • Android毕设客户
    优质
    本项目为基于Android平台的毕业设计作品,包含完整的客户端应用和服务器端源代码,旨在展示移动应用开发全流程。 这是我完成的毕业设计项目(包括论文、结构图及源码),涵盖了Android客户端与Java Socket服务器以及Java Web服务器的开发,实现了完整项目的构建。 您可以直接在客户端中运行apk文件以查看效果。(请注意,我已经在我的阿里云服务器上启用了Web服务和Socket服务。) 此外,该项目包含详细的说明文档。 希望这个项目能够帮助到更多的人!
  • C++文件传输Socket和客户
    优质
    本项目提供一个用C++编写的完整解决方案,实现基于Socket协议的文件传输功能。包括服务端与客户端两部分源代码,支持跨平台操作。 基于C++ MFC的TCP网络通信服务器和客户端源码包括了服务器启动、客户端连接、发送数据与接收数据功能,是最简化的TCP通信代码,没有多余的额外内容。 NetworkFileTransfer:这是一个用于学习Qt编程的Qt网络文件传输项目,包含客户端和服务端。